AboutEmployment Hero

Employment Hero is an AI-powered Employment Operating System (EmploymentOS). It provides software for businesses to manage their own teams, and a managed service called HeroForce that acts as the legal employer in 180+ countries, handling contracts, payroll, and compliance. It’s designed for SMEs and growing organizations across almost any industry.

AboutVestwell

Vestwell is a modern savings platform for employers, advisors, and individuals. It powers retirement plans like 401(k)s and 403(b)s, plus education savings, student loan help, and emergency funds. The goal is to make saving simple and accessible for everyone, across all 50 states. 🏦

Core Platform Scope

Employment Hero is a broad employment operating system. Vestwell is a focused savings platform.

Tie

Employment Hero provides an all-in-one hub for HR, payroll, recruitment, and benefits. It's designed to manage your entire workforce lifecycle from a single system. Vestwell specializes in retirement and savings plans. It powers 401(k)s, 403(b)s, education savings, and student loan repayment from one unified interface. The key difference is scope. Employment Hero aims to replace multiple HR tools. Vestwell aims to be the best at administering savings benefits. If you need comprehensive HR management, Employment Hero is the platform. If your primary need is retirement plan administration, Vestwell is the specialist.

Global vs. U.S. Focus

Employment Hero offers global employment services. Vestwell is built for the U.S. market.

Employment Hero

Employment Hero's HeroForce acts as a legal Employer of Record in over 180 countries. It handles contracts, payroll, and compliance for international hires. Vestwell operates across all 50 U.S. states. It does not mention international availability outside the U.S. This makes Employment Hero the clear choice for companies hiring across borders. Vestwell is optimized for domestic U.S. benefits administration. A startup hiring engineers in Germany would use Employment Hero. A company setting up its first 401(k) for U.S. employees would use Vestwell.

Employment Hero Pricing
$0–$8211/month

Employment Hero pricing: Employment Hero offers tiered subscription plans starting at $10 per employee/month for HR essentials, alongside specialized AI recruitment and payroll solutions. Costs scale based on team size and selected modules, with both monthly and annual billing options available for specific services like the AI Recruitment Agent at $199/month (billed annually).

Professional managed services under the HeroForce brand are also offered with custom pricing, allowing businesses to tailor their plan to their specific needs and workforce size. Note that a minimum of 10 users is required for core subscriptions and pricing is quoted in AUD excluding GST for the Australian market.

Some plans also offer flexibility for single entity or global expansion setups, simplifying the complexity of multi-national compliance and local payroll management through their unified platform infrastructure. Businesses can scale their usage of AI-powered tools such as video interviewing and candidate scoring as their hiring needs grow over time, ensuring they only pay for the capacity they actually use each month through transparent tiered pricing.

Pricing Notes

Context that may affect total cost of ownership.
  • Employment Hero requires a minimum of 10 users for core HR plans.
  • Employment Hero pricing is quoted in AUD excluding GST for Australia.
  • Vestwell pricing is not public and requires a custom quote based on business size.
  • Employment Hero has add-on costs for SMS ($0.18/SMS) and super processing ($0.30/employee).
  • Neither platform offers a clear free trial for all services; demos are available.

Frequently Asked Questions

Which is better for small teams: Employment Hero or Vestwell?

Vestwell is often better for small teams focused solely on retirement benefits. It has plans for very small businesses and offers 1:1 onboarding. Employment Hero requires a minimum of 10 users for its core HR plans, making it less accessible for the smallest teams.

Does Employment Hero handle retirement plans like Vestwell?

Employment Hero offers integrated employee benefits, which can include retirement plans. However, Vestwell is a dedicated retirement and savings platform with specialized features. Vestwell's core focus is administering 401(k)s and 403(b)s, while retirement is one module within Employment Hero's larger HR system.

Can I use Employment Hero and Vestwell together?

Potentially, but it's not the typical use case. You could use Employment Hero for HR, payroll, and recruitment, while using Vestwell for your retirement plan administration. However, this would involve managing two separate platforms and data flows.

Is Vestwell easier to set up than Employment Hero?

Yes, Vestwell is generally quicker to set up for its specific purpose. Its onboarding is focused on configuring your savings plan. Employment Hero is a more comprehensive platform, so its implementation covers more areas and may take longer.

Which platform has better mobile apps for employees?

Employment Hero's Work app is more feature-rich as a 'superapp' for payslips, leave, and benefits. Vestwell's mobile app is focused and clean for managing savings. Your preference depends on whether you want a single app for all work functions or a dedicated app for savings.

How do the pricing models compare between Employment Hero and Vestwell?

Employment Hero uses per-employee monthly pricing with tiered plans starting at $10/user. Vestwell uses a base plan plus a per-participant fee, with all pricing provided via custom quotes. Employment Hero's model is more transparent upfront, while Vestwell's is fully customized.
